A secured party shall apply or pay over for application the cash proceeds of collection or enforcement under section 41-09-104 in the following order to:

(1)The reasonable expenses of collection and enforcement and, to the extent provided for by agreement and not prohibited by law, reasonable attorney's fees and legal expenses incurred by the secured party;
(2)The satisfaction of obligations secured by the security interest or agricultural lien under which the collection or enforcement is made; and
